If the money supply is $6,000, velocity is 5, and Real GDP is 10,000 units of output, then the price level is _____________. If
atroni [7]

Answer and Explanation:

The computation is shown below:

The Price level in the normal case

= Money supply ÷ Real GDP × Velocity

= $6,000 ÷ 10,000 units × $5

= $3

Now in the case when the money supply doubled i.e $12,000

So, the price level is

= Money supply ÷ Real GDP × Velocity

= $12,000 ÷ 10,000 units × $5

= $6

When the money supply doubles, the price level is also doubled that indicated the direct relationship between the price level and money supply

Cash equivalents are highly liquid investments that are bothA : money market funds and have a maturity date of one year or less.
Ber [7]

Answer:

D : readily convertible and very close to their maturity dates.

Explanation:

Cash equivalents are current liquid assets and comprise cash in hand,  cash at the bank, and short term investment whose maturity is in three months or less. A company's total value of cash and cash equivalents is recorded at the top line of the balance sheet as a current asset. They are the most liquid asset of a company.

For an asset to be classified as a cash equivalent, it must have the ability to convert to cash easily. Its value should be relatively stable and be determined with ease. Cash equivalents indicate the financial strengths of a business and its ability to offset the current liabilities.
